Physical Withdrawal Symptoms



You may experience physical withdrawal symptoms within the very first 24 hr of detoxification. Throughout this time around, your body is getting used to the absence of the material it has actually become depending on. These symptoms can vary depending on the sort of drug you have actually been utilizing and the intensity of your addiction. Usual physical withdrawal symptoms consist of:

- Nausea or vomiting
- Throwing up
- Sweating
- Drinking
- Muscular tissue aches
- Insomnia

You might also experience frustrations, boosted heart rate, and changes in hunger. It's important to remember that these signs are momentary and a sign that your body is starting to recover.

The medical personnel at the rehabilitation facility will very closely monitor your withdrawal signs and give you with the essential support and medication to help take care of any pain you may experience.

Medical Support and Interventions



The clinical staff at the rehabilitation center will offer various interventions and assistance to ensure your safety and wellness throughout the detoxification procedure. They understand that detoxification can be a difficult and awkward experience, but they're below to help you every step of the means. Their primary objective is to maintain you safe and comfortable as your body adjusts to the absence of medications or alcohol.

To achieve this, the medical personnel will carefully monitor your important signs and offer medications, if needed, to manage withdrawal symptoms. They'll also supply emotional support and therapy to attend to any type of psychological or mental wellness issues that might develop throughout detox. Additionally, they'll enlighten you concerning the detox process, including what to expect and exactly how to handle desires or triggers.
